Factors Affecting Cost
Replacing a TPO roof in Seattle, WA involves several key considerations. The process typically includes selecting appropriate materials, assessing the scope of work, navigating local permitting requirements, and understanding potential additional costs. This overview provides a neutral outline of what is involved in a typical TPO roof replacement project in the Seattle area.
- Materials: TPO roofing membranes are commonly used for their durability and reflective properties, suitable for flat or low-slope roofs typical in Seattle.
- Size and Scope: Projects can range from small residential sections to extensive commercial roofs, impacting overall complexity and duration.
- Labor Complexity: The installation process requires specialized skills, especially on roofs with complex shapes, multiple penetrations, or existing layers to remove.
- Permitting: Local building permits are generally required for roof replacements, with inspections ensuring compliance with Seattle building codes.
- Additional Considerations: Extras such as insulation upgrades, roof penetrations, or drainage modifications may influence project costs and timeline.
